Abstract
CYP24A1 and PHEX gene mutations are rare and can cause hypercalcemia, hypervitaminosis D and elevated FGF23 levels. Fluconazole, an antifungal medication, has shown therapeutic benefit in achieving normocalcemia plus normalisation of vitamin D levels in this case report.
